Output de11c327a1125386334936b07568b5f263186aa3f88a4eaf252825020e9c51d3:0

value
2045834
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 955521bc104141918bb4fd181a9a47cb0798d2ba OP_EQUALVERIFY OP_CHECKSIG
address
1EcbfeFRScPSkU3GzDLG8Bh4vcZWbEaCrd
transaction
de11c327a1125386334936b07568b5f263186aa3f88a4eaf252825020e9c51d3
confirmations
430715
spent
true